namespace解决了什么?文章来源:https://www.toymoban.com/news/detail-659733.html
- 解决了变量的跨域访问问题
- C++解决了C语言不能访问全局变量的问题
#include<iostream>
using namespace std;
namespace glo{
int global = 50;
}
int main(int argc, char *argv[])
{
int global = 20;
std::cout << global << endl;
std::cout << glo::global << endl;
return 0;
}
推荐一个零声学院项目课,个人觉得老师讲得不错,分享给大家:
零声白金学习卡(含基础架构/高性能存储/golang云原生/音视频/Linux内核)
https://xxetb.xet.tech/s/VsFMs文章来源地址https://www.toymoban.com/news/detail-659733.html
到了这里,关于C++ namespace对全局变量屏蔽的工程化意义解读的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!